TRIANGULATED STOOLS

This book is about a flatpack stool design, that looks like an extruded

triangle.

Be careful, it’s riveting (the story, not the stool).

It all started when the Art Center College of Design Eco-Council decided it wanted to have furniture in the school’s rooftop garden.

But this book will focus on its pre-rooftop life...

Over the course of 12 weeks a total of 10 students participated at varrying intervals in the design of these stools.

As the stool design was getting refined by the main team, an adventurous commando attempted to visualize what the stools could become next if a BUNCH of flat pack parts were to be made available...

They were designed to fit into the school’s ecosystem, they were designed to:

- provide shop training - (uses all the basic machines)

- provide a platform for collaboration - (the production is meant to be split up)

- support inventivity - (the stool is totally hackable)

- be easy to fix -(each part can be independently replaced)

they were also designed for:

DISASSEMBLY

HACKABILITY

TRANSPORTBILITY

PLAYABILITY
